AngularJS Authentication with JWT

AngularJS Authentication with JWT course by @kentcdodds #angularjs

  • JSON Web Tokens (JWT) are a more modern approach to authentication.
  • As the web moves to a greater separation between the client and server, JWT provides a terrific alternative to traditional cookie based authentication models.
  • For more information on JWT visit http://jwt.io/

    In this series, we’ll be building a simple application to get random user information from a node server with an Angular client.

  • We’ll then implement JWT to protect the random user resource on the server and then work through the frontend to get JWT authentication working.
  • By the end, we’ll have an application which has a single username/password combination (for simplicity) and uses tokens to authorize the client to see the random user information.

JSON Web Tokens (JWT) are a more modern approach to authentication. As the web moves to a greater separation between the client and server, JWT provides a terrific alternative to traditional cookie based authentication models. For more information on JWT visit http://jwt.io/

In this series, we’ll be building a simple application to get random user information from a node server with an Angular client. We’ll then implement JWT to protect the random user resource on the server and then work through the frontend to get JWT authentication working.

By the end, we’ll have an application which has a single username/password combination (for simplicity) and uses tokens to authorize the client to see the random user information. You’ll be able to login, get random users, and logout.

Continue reading “AngularJS Authentication with JWT”

Angular Or React: Learning curve

#Angular Or #React: Learning curve  #js #javascript #jsx #reactjs #angularjs

  • Many people just use React as the “V” in the MVC architecture, which means you have to use other components and patterns with it in order to create a single page app.
  • It also means you can use React with other popular frameworks such as Angular and Backbone and while using React tools for optimizing the performance of your application.
  • To build an SPA without using other popular frameworks, you need to use React’s Router as a way to organize your data flow.
  • It takes time to learn how the router works and how the data flows through your React app, so Angular has an advantage here by providing everything out of the box.
  • But in the end, if you spend some time reading through different articles on how to create and structure your app, you’ll build a fast and maintainable solution which will be easy for new people to dive in and work on.

Angular or React: Learning curve. Learning Angular looks deceptively easy. At first, it’s easy to understand the purpose of different directives like ng-repeat, ng-if, ng-show and ng-hide. Sometimes, there are even situations when you don’t need to write a single line of JS to make your app work. Web Development.
Continue reading “Angular Or React: Learning curve”

Top 10 Java stories of January

  • Doug Schaefer, a software architect at QNX working on the Momentics IDE, as well as an Eclipse contributor as co-lead of the Eclipse CDT project and a member of various Eclipse councils and committees, announced in a blog post in late 2016 that he is working on Eclipse Two, “the real next-generation Eclipse IDE based on Electron.”
  • Even when programming a small web application, it is not possible to examine every part of the software at any given time.
  • With NetBeans and IntelliJ ever at its heels, the Eclipse development environment has been battling to hold sway over the Java community.
  • In November 2015, Dirk Lemmermann and Alexander Casall) had a JavaOne session about JavaFX Real World Applications.
  • This article explores the implementation of Angular 2 with TypeScript since Angular 2 was developed based on TypeScript, which offers advantages in development in relation to what classic JavaScript and ECMAScript2015/ES6 have to offer.

Eclipse Two seems to be the new buzzword people are humming this January and it looks like functional programming is here to stay. JavaFX, Angular and NetBeans are also on the top 10 list.
Continue reading “Top 10 Java stories of January”

4 Things Vue.js Got Right – JS Dojo – Medium

  • The creators know that there are already plenty of libraries out there to help you iterate arrays or handle promises and HTTP requests, so you won’t find any of that duplicated in Vue.This focus allows Vue to avoid the bloat of other frameworks.
  • These integrate deeply with Vue but are completely optional.Here’s a great example of Vue’s focus ethos in action: Vue creator Evan You announced last week that vue-resources, the official AJAX library for Vue, would be retired from the Vue organisation.
  • For more experienced developers, this simplicity allows immediate productivity.If the success of jQuery is anything to go by, Vue’s standing as the simplest of the frameworks could take it a long way.I .
  • really care about the approachability part of Vue, which is rooted in the belief that technology should be enabling more people to build thingsEvan You, creator of Vue.js — Between The WiresFlexibilityIf you want to write a quick and easy app that will run straight from the browser, Vue has got you covered.
  • For example, if you have a preferred method for writing your templates, Vue lets you do it in any of these ways:Write your template in an HTML fileWrite your template in a string in a Javascript fileUse JSX in a Javascript fileMake your template in pure Javascript using virtual nodesThis flexibility makes it easy to switch to Vue because React developers, Angular developers, or developers new to JS frameworks would all find Vue’s design familiar.Copying competitorsA lot of what Vue is getting right is what its predecessors already got right.

Whether you’re suffering from Javascript fatigue, ES anxiety, post-webpack stress disorder or any other kind of web development malady, the last thing you probably want to do now is look at another…
Continue reading “4 Things Vue.js Got Right – JS Dojo – Medium”

AngularJs Practical Session to be an Angular Jedi Coupon Save 83 %

AngularJs Practical Session to be an Angular Jedi
☞

  • You’ll be able to start building your own single page application using AngularJS.
  • Who likes to learn angularjs with practical sessions, this is for you.
  • AngularJS is a complete JavaScript framework for creating dynamic and interactive applications in HTML.
  • You will understand what is directives, services and controllers
  • The course is designed to cover the core features of the framework using practical, easy to follow examples using 1.x version of angular and latest stable version is 1.6.0.

Coupon 100 10 15 75 Get started to learn angularjs with real world practical examples and become web development industry expert
Continue reading “AngularJs Practical Session to be an Angular Jedi Coupon Save 83 %”

AngularJs Practical Session to be an Angular Jedi Coupon Save 83 %

AngularJs Practical Session to be an Angular Jedi
☞

  • You’ll be able to start building your own single page application using AngularJS.
  • Who likes to learn angularjs with practical sessions, this is for you.
  • AngularJS is a complete JavaScript framework for creating dynamic and interactive applications in HTML.
  • You will understand what is directives, services and controllers
  • The course is designed to cover the core features of the framework using practical, easy to follow examples using 1.x version of angular and latest stable version is 1.6.0.

Coupon 100 10 15 75 Get started to learn angularjs with real world practical examples and become web development industry expert
Continue reading “AngularJs Practical Session to be an Angular Jedi Coupon Save 83 %”

AngularJs Practical Session to be an Angular Jedi Coupon Save 83 %

AngularJs Practical Session to be an Angular Jedi
☞ 

#angularjs

  • You’ll be able to start building your own single page application using AngularJS.
  • Who likes to learn angularjs with practical sessions, this is for you.
  • AngularJS is a complete JavaScript framework for creating dynamic and interactive applications in HTML.
  • You will understand what is directives, services and controllers
  • The course is designed to cover the core features of the framework using practical, easy to follow examples using 1.x version of angular and latest stable version is 1.6.0.

Coupon 100 10 15 75 Get started to learn angularjs with real world practical examples and become web development industry expert
Continue reading “AngularJs Practical Session to be an Angular Jedi Coupon Save 83 %”